Step 1
Open and drain the chickpeas.
Step 2
In a large saucepan, brown the ground beef with the minced onion and garlic powder. Drain and add the browned ground beef to the pressure cooker insert.
Step 3
Stir in the drained chickpeas, diced tomatoes, beef broth and chili powder into the electric pressure cooker insert. Season with salt and pepper to taste.
Step 4
Steam valve: Sealing.
Step 5
Cook on: Manual/High for 15 minute
Step 6
Release: Natural or Quick.
Step 7
Prepare veggies.
Step 8
Serve Instant Pot Chickpea Beef Chili with sour cream and shredded cheese garnish, and a side of veggies.
